Effective communication and collaboration tools are critical for every team in the modern, digital workplace. Slack has become one of the most popular platforms for team communication, with a wide range of features that improve productivity and streamline processes. Although Slack's core chat and channel functions are well-known to many users, the platform offers several solid but lesser-known features that may significantly improve team productivity and cooperation.
In this article, we'll look at some helpful Slack features you might not know. These features, which range from powerful search capabilities and seamless interfaces to custom shortcuts and workflow automation, are made to optimize your work processes and support your team's continued communication and productivity. If you're a novice or an experienced Slack user, the platform, discovering these hidden gems, will empower you to harness Slack's full potential and transform the way you work.
Custom Shortcuts and Slash Commands:
Slack's custom shortcuts and slash commands are powerful tools designed to enhance productivity by streamlining workflows and integrating seamlessly with other applications. Custom shortcuts allow users to create personalized actions that automate routine tasks directly from the Slack interface. Using Slack's Workflow Builder, teams can set up shortcuts that trigger specific actions, such as sending reminders, logging information in external systems, or initiating complex workflows. Slash commands, on the other hand, provide a quick and efficient way to interact with apps and services via text-based commands entered directly into Slack's message input field. These commands start with a forward slash (/).
They can perform a variety of functions, from setting reminders (/remind) and adding tasks to project management tools (/todo) to starting video calls (/zoom) and retrieving data from integrated apps. Teams can also create custom slash commands tailored to their needs, enabling seamless integration with their tech stack through web hooks and APIs. This flexibility allows teams to execute tasks swiftly without switching between different platforms, saving time and reducing friction in daily operations. Both custom shortcuts and slash commands empower users to automate and personalize their Slack experience, turning it into a centralized hub for communication and task management, enhancing overall efficiency and collaboration.
Workflow Builder:
Slack's Workflow Builder is a powerful automation tool that enables users to create custom workflows within the Slack interface, streamlining processes and reducing repetitive tasks. It allows teams to automate routine activities without coding skills, making it accessible for everyone in an organization. With Workflow Builder, users can design workflows by setting triggers and actions. Triggers can include events like a new message, a user joining a channel, or a scheduled time. Once a trigger is activated, Workflow Builder executes a series of actions, such as sending messages, collecting information via forms, routing data to other applications, or notifying specific team members. This flexibility enables teams to automate onboarding new employees, gathering feedback, organizing team stand-ups, and more. For instance, a workflow could automatically welcome new members to a channel and provide them with essential resources.
It can also handle approvals, where requests submitted via Slack are sent to the appropriate approvers, who can approve or deny them directly from Slack. The Workflow Builder integrates seamlessly with other apps, allowing data and notifications to flow smoothly across the tools a team already uses. By reducing manual intervention, Workflow Builder increases productivity and minimizes errors, ensuring that processes are consistent and reliable. Slack's Workflow Builder empowers teams to optimize their workflows, improve efficiency, and focus more on high-value tasks by automating the mundane.
Message Reminders:
Slack's message reminders are a helpful feature that helps users manage their time and tasks by setting reminders for specific messages directly within the Slack interface. This feature ensures that important messages are not overlooked, allowing users to return to them at a later time that suits their schedule. To set a reminder, users can hover over a message and click the three-dot icon (more actions), then select "Remind me about this" to choose a specific time, such as in 20 minutes, 1 hour, or even a custom date and time. This functionality is particularly beneficial for teams working in fast-paced environments, as it allows them to prioritize and organize their workload without losing track of important information.
Additionally, users can manage their reminders by typing /reminding lists into the message input field, which displays all active reminders and offers options to edit or delete them as needed. Beyond individual use, reminders can also be set for entire channels or groups, making them valuable for team collaboration. For example, a user can remind a team about an upcoming deadline or meeting using the /remind command followed by the @channel or @here mention. This flexibility allows teams to keep everyone informed and aligned without cluttering personal calendars with minor tasks. Slack reminders integrate with the overall communication flow, enhancing productivity by allowing users to capture and recall important tasks and discussions efficiently. By leveraging message reminders, users can ensure nothing slips through the cracks, making it easier to stay organized and focused amidst the constant influx of information typical in digital workspaces.
Pinning Messages and Files:
Slack's pinning feature allows users to highlight and easily access crucial messages and files within a channel or direct message, helping teams keep critical information organized and readily available. By pinning a message or file, you create a centralized reference point for important content, such as project plans, deadlines, or key announcements, ensuring that this information does not get lost in conversations. To pin an item, users hover over the message or file, click the "More actions" (three dots) icon, and select "Pin to channel" or "Pin to this conversation." Once pinned, these items appear in a dedicated section within the channel or conversation, making it easy for team members to locate and review them at any time. This is especially useful for new team members or anyone who needs to catch up on the most relevant discussions and resources without scrolling through extensive chat histories.
Additionally, pinned messages and files can be managed by clicking on the "Pinned Items" icon in the channel header, which displays a list of all pinned content. Here, users with the necessary permissions can unpin items once irrelevant, keeping the workspace tidy and up-to-date. By using the pinning feature effectively, teams can improve their information management practices, ensure everyone has quick access to critical materials, and enhance overall collaboration and productivity in Slack.
Advanced Search:
Slack's advanced search capabilities empower users to efficiently locate messages, files, and other content within their workspace, making it easier to find specific information amidst extensive conversations and data. The search function can be accessed by clicking on the search bar at the top of the Slack window or using the keyboard shortcut Ctrl + F (or Cmd + F on Mac). Slack offers a variety of search modifiers and filters to refine searches and pinpoint the exact content needed. For example, users can filter results by date using keywords like before, after, or on, followed by a date. They can also search by the user from:@username to find messages from a specific person or by channel using #channelname.
Additionally, it has links and reaction filters that can be used to find messages containing links or those that have received a specific emoji reaction. Users can also employ keywords such as during to specify a period or near to find messages close to a specific location or topic mentioned. The search results can be further refined by sorting them by relevance or recency, allowing users to customize their search experience according to their needs. Users can combine multiple search modifiers to narrow down results, such as from @john in #marketing before:2024-07-01, for even more specificity. This robust search functionality is particularly beneficial in large organizations where information can quickly become scattered across numerous channels and threads. By leveraging Slack's advanced search, teams can save time, reduce frustration, and ensure that vital information is easily accessible when needed, enhancing overall productivity and collaboration within the workspace.
Keyboard Shortcuts:
Slack's keyboard shortcuts are designed to enhance productivity by allowing users to navigate and perform tasks quickly without relying on a mouse. These shortcuts cover many functions, enabling users to manage conversations, switch between channels, send messages, and perform various other actions with just a few keystrokes. For instance, pressing Ctrl + K (or Cmd + K on Mac) opens the Quick Switcher, which allows users to rapidly jump between channels and direct messages by typing the channel name or contact.
To compose a new message, users can press Ctrl + N (or Cmd + N on Mac) to open the message box. They were navigating between channels seamlessly with Alt + ↑/↓ (or Option + ↑/↓ on Mac), letting users move up and down their channel list effortlessly. To quickly mark all messages as read, Shift + Esc clears unread notifications, while Esc marks messages in the current channel as read. Users can also utilize Ctrl + / (or Cmd + / on Mac) to view a complete list of available keyboard shortcuts as a handy reference. Managing threads is simplified with Alt + Shift + ↑/↓ (or Option + Shift + ↑/↓ on Mac) to navigate through thread messages.
Additionally, users can start or join a huddle using Ctrl + Shift + H (or Cmd + Shift + H on Mac), promoting quick voice communication. These shortcuts are especially valuable in fast-paced work environments, where minimizing time spent on navigation can significantly boost efficiency. By integrating keyboard shortcuts into their daily routine, Slack users can streamline their workflow, reduce reliance on the mouse, and focus more on the content of their work rather than on navigating the platform, ultimately enhancing overall productivity.
Do Not Disturb (DND) Mode:
Slack's Do Not Disturb (DND) mode is a feature that allows users to mute notifications temporarily, helping them focus on tasks without interruptions. This feature is essential for managing workflow and maintaining productivity, especially in busy work environments where constant notifications can be distracting. Users can activate DND mode manually by clicking on their profile picture, selecting "Pause notifications," and choosing 30 minutes, 1 hour, or until the next day. Alternatively, they can set a custom schedule to automatically enable DND during specific hours, such as non-working times or regular focus periods, ensuring that work-life balance is maintained and users aren't disturbed outside work hours.
During DND, Slack suppresses notifications for mentions, direct messages, and reactions, but users can still access messages and respond at their convenience. This mode is indicated by a crescent moon icon next to the user's profile, signaling to colleagues that the user is unavailable. Despite being in DND mode, users can allow exceptions for specific channels or contacts, ensuring critical messages can still get through. Team members attempting to send a direct message during this period receive an automatic notification informing them that the recipient is in DND mode and the expected time when they will be available.
This transparency helps set expectations about response times. By leveraging DND mode, individuals can better manage their attention, reduce stress from information overload, and focus on deep work, ultimately improving productivity and job satisfaction. This feature also supports team norms around respecting personal time and boundaries, contributing to a healthier and more respectful work environment.
Conclusion
In conclusion, Slack offers features designed to enhance productivity and streamline communication, making it a versatile tool for modern teams. From custom shortcuts and slash commands that automate repetitive tasks to the Workflow Builder that facilitates complex processes without coding, these tools empower users to tailor Slack to their specific needs and workflows. Advanced search capabilities ensure that finding crucial information is quick and precise, while keyboard shortcuts enable seamless navigation and efficient task management. Features like message reminders, pinning, and Do Not Disturb mode further contribute to a more organized and focused work environment, allowing users to stay on top of important tasks and manage their time effectively. By leveraging these functionalities, teams can optimize communication, reduce manual work, and foster a more collaborative and productive workspace. Embracing these features enhances individual efficiency and supports a more cohesive and well-managed team dynamic, ultimately driving success and improving overall work experience.